How do I cancel AI on my phone?

      “Canceling” AI on your phone isn’t a single, straightforward action, as AI features are deeply integrated into various parts of your device and operating system. Instead, you’ll generally be looking to disable specific AI-powered functionalities.

      Here’s a general guide on how to approach this, keeping in mind that the exact steps and terminology might vary slightly depending on your phone’s make, model, and operating system (Android or iOS):

      General Steps to Disable AI Features:

      1. Open your phone’s Settings app. This is usually represented by a gear icon.

      2. Look for sections related to AI, Privacy, or Smart Features. Common headings might include:

        • Privacy
        • AI Settings
        • Advanced Features (especially on Samsung)
        • Google (on Android)
        • Apple Intelligence & Siri (on iPhone)
        • Apps & Notifications (for app-specific AI)
      3. Identify specific AI-related features and toggle them off. These can include:

        • Voice Assistants:

          • Google Assistant: Go to Settings > Apps > Assistant > Digital assistants from Google, and you might find an option to toggle it off. You can also disable “Hey Google” voice commands.
          • Siri (iPhone): Settings > Apple Intelligence & Siri, then toggle off Apple Intelligence and/or Siri features.
          • Bixby (Samsung): You can often disable Bixby or set Google Assistant as your default assistant in settings.
        • Camera Enhancements: Look for options like “Scene optimizer,” “AI enhancements,” or “Auto HDR” within your camera app’s settings.

        • Smart Notifications: In Settings > Apps & Notifications or Notifications, look for “Adaptive Notifications” or “Smart Notifications” and toggle them off.

        • Predictive Text/Smart Compose/Smart Reply:

          • For keyboard settings, go to Settings > System > Languages & Inputs > On-Screen Keyboard. Select your keyboard (e.g., Gboard, Swiftkey) and turn off “Predictive Text,” “Show suggestion strip,” and “Next-word suggestions.”
          • In apps like Gmail, look for “Smart Compose” and “Smart Reply” in their individual settings.
        • AI-powered Search and Recommendations:

          • For Google-related recommendations, go to Settings > Google > Manage your Google Account > Data & Privacy. Scroll down to “Web & App Activity” and toggle off “Include Chrome history and activity from sites, apps, and devices that use Google services.”
          • Some phone launchers also have AI-driven search features that can be disabled in their settings.
        • Adaptive Battery/Battery Optimization: In Settings > Battery or Device Care (Samsung), look for “Adaptive Battery” or “Battery Optimization” and turn it off to prevent AI from restricting background app activity.

        • Photo Editing Features: In Google Photos or your phone’s gallery app, look for options like “Suggested Edits” and “Memories” and toggle them off.

        • Samsung-specific AI (Galaxy AI): On compatible Samsung phones, you might find a dedicated “Galaxy AI” section in Settings where you can individually disable various features like Live Translate, Interpreter mode, Note Assist, Chat Translation, etc. There might also be an option to limit AI processing to “on-device only” to prevent data from being sent to external servers.

      Important Considerations:

      • App-Specific AI: Many apps have their own AI features. You’ll need to go into the settings of individual apps (e.g., social media apps, navigation apps) to see if you can disable their personalized or AI-driven functions.
      • Privacy Settings: While you’re in your phone’s settings, it’s a good idea to review your general privacy settings to control data collection and personalization.
      • Factory Reset: If you want to erase all AI capabilities and stored data linked to these features, a factory reset is an option, but be sure to back up all your important data first.
      • Not all AI can be fully disabled: Modern smartphones are designed with AI deeply integrated into their core functionality for performance, efficiency, and user experience. It may not be possible to completely remove all AI, but you can significantly limit its active features and data collection.
      • Updates: Phone manufacturers may release updates that change how AI features are managed, so it’s good to periodically check for new options.
